            Make sure you are NOT using the power swing or Guess Pitch or you will get too many HR's.
            Can't see how anyone can smash a lot of hr's with no Guess Pitch and no power swing especially with higher pitch speed. Unless the K ratio is also high due to just sitting a certain pitch the whole game...

                I think the pitching is close enough for this fantasy world...
                I think it's mainly that classic pitching seems "off" this year. Lot more random than last year and quite frankly a tad too random. Some of the things I've seen happen have no rhyme or reason as to why. However I can usually pinpoint pitches too well with meter pitching, plus I don't like the clutter on the screen.

                You can up the ability of the pitching BUT the higher you go the less difference you'll see from pitcher to pitcher. I'm satisfied with how things are though and will ride it out. This is my MLB after all

                            Sky thanks for the tips on the injury slider. I now simulate games with it at 0 and play games with it at 7. That way I get a realistic amount of injuries both in simulations and gameplay.

                            Creating my injuries got old after awhile.
